PM Shehbaz Sharif urges digital wallet awareness for Ramadan relief

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if has called on relevant ministries, the central bank, and private partners to enhance public awareness about using digital wallets to ensure effective utilization of the Rs 20 billion ($71.4 million) Ramadan relief package. This initiative provides Rs5,000 ($17.87) to approximately 4 million families nationwide to support them during the holy month of Ramadan.

During a visit to the National Telecommunication Corporation Headquarters, Sharif was briefed that while around 2.8 million eligible accounts had been credited, only 683,000 accounts had seen withdrawals. He expressed concern over the 22% withdrawal rate, attributing it to a lack of public awareness. He urged the central bank governor to join the campaign to maximize the program’s reach.

Traditionally, Ramadan relief was administered through state-run utility stores offering essential commodities at reduced prices. However, issues like long queues, limited stock, and verification challenges led to the shift toward digital disbursement. Despite the move to digital wallets aiming to streamline the process, the current low withdrawal rates indicate a need for increased public education on accessing these funds.
